## Build Provenance — Coldpath Handlers

Cold starts on the Murkfield serverless tier are provenance-sensitive: the init snapshot is baked at build time, so any unverified layer inflates startup by ~800ms. Always rebuild handlers from the pinned base image; never patch layers in place. Provenance attestations live alongside each artifact in the Coldpath store. When auditing a slow cold start, match the deployed snapshot against the token that follows.

build token for yaweg-fawig: htk4_45ef

Capacity note for the Fennelgrid sidecar review. Aggregation window widened to cut emit rate; per-pod memory ceiling holds at current cardinality (~12k series). CPU flat. Risk: buffer overflow if a tenant spikes labels — mitigated by the drop policy. No node-pool changes needed for the Caldermoor cluster this quarter. Review the flush and buffer settings before merge. Constants under review are below.

limits module of yafop-hahag:
QUOTAS = {
    "tamwyn": 652,
    "prawyn": 731,
}

**Action item (Telemetry payload compression).** Following the Driftline outage, uncompressed telemetry payloads saturated the ingest tier. Owner: Parl team. Enable gzip on the collector by next sprint and add payload-size alerts. Expected reduction: ~70%. Rollout plan, benchmarks, and config flags are documented on the internal page here:

operations page: https://confluence.qorvelsys.internal/browse/projects/projects/f004fd0d

Internal Memo — Inventory Write-Down

To: Heads of Department

Following the annual count at the Dunmere warehouse, we will record a write-down on obsolete Quillmark printer components. The adjustment affects Q4 results and has been reviewed by finance. Department forecasts should be updated by Friday. No staffing changes are planned. For context, the related strategic note appears immediately below.

confidential, tajef-bagag: Only 5 of the 140 pilot accounts renewed Wenath, so a churn review is set for January 15.

Subject: DR drill Thursday — contrast audit tooling included

Hi all — quick heads-up for future maintainers digging through this thread. Thursday's disaster-recovery drill includes restoring the Huemark contrast-audit service from cold backups. We'll verify the WCAG scoring jobs resume and the audit history survives the failover. If the restore console prompts you, it wants the standing recovery passphrase, which is:

unlock words, hahip-baduf: holwyn-istath-julvan